Anxiety symptoms are relatively common among children and adolescents and can interfere with functioning. The prevalence of anxiety and the relationship between anxiety and school performance were examined among elementary, middle, and high school students.
Mazzone, L., Ducci, F., Scoto, M.c., Passaniti, E., D'Arrigo, V.g., Vitiello, B. (2007). The role of anxiety symptoms in school performance in a community sample of children and adolescents. BMC PUBLIC HEALTH, 7(1), 347 [10.1186/1471-2458-7-347].
